This can be a serious problem with Win10 if you use OneDrive and have your accounts sych'd -as that can force changes to the other devices.

 

If you use a Microsoft account for your Win10 access (you would know that because the login screen shows either a pin code or an email address), then you can go to the Microsoft account reset website: https://account.live.com/password/reset -or - go to the Sign in Microsoft Account website: https://login.live.com/

Then follow these instructions:
1) Click/tap on the Can't access your account link
2) Select why you can't sign into your account and click/tap on Next
3) Enter the email address of your Microsoft account, type in the characters displayed onscreen, and click/tap Next
4) Select how you would like to get your security code to verify your identity, click/tap Next
5) Enter your security code sent using the method selected in 4) above, click/tap Next
6) If you have enabled tw0-step verification, repeat steps 4) and 5) above using a different method to send you a different security code
7) Type in a new password, click/tap Next
😎 Your Microsoft account has been recovered -- click/tap on Next -- and you're done

Fingerprint Sensor / Forced Reset

 

If the fingerprint sensor suddenly stops working on your computer

OR

If the computer is not issuing errors but still won’t let you log in,

Consider trying a Forced Reset (power reset).

 

Reminders

 

 A Forced Reset is NOT a “recovery” and does not remove your data – this reset merely forces the computer to load the Operating System from disk. 

 

Forced Reset does not harm a healthy system nor does it “fix” problems not related to a clean start.
